A member asked:

Im 25 weeks pregnant & my baby doesn't really move or kick to the loud music. he kicked maybe once or twice. more when i lay down is this normal?

A doctor has provided 1 answer
Dr. Jeff Livingston answered

Specializes in Obstetrics and Gynecology

5 per hour: Babies live in 45 min sleep/wake cycles. They move less when they are sleeping and then more when they are awake. Most patients can feel at least 5/hr when they concentrate on it. Lying down brings the uterus closer to your abdominal wall making it easier to feel.
